A = {x|x is a whole number between 2 and 10} B = {x|x is an even whole number bigger than 2 and less than 10}. Solutions: we can write a as {2, 3, 4, 5, 6, 7, 8, 9, 10} and b as {4, 6, 8}. Hence, a and b are not disjoint (recall, two sets are disjoint if their intersection is empty). The false answer is: a and b are disjoint. (2) let a and b be sets such that n(a) = 16, n(b) = 23 and n(a b) = 32. Solutions: using the formula n(a b) = n(a) + n(b) n(a b), we get.
